The Bluetooth Audio to Dante Interface (Model 500554) is a two-way audio transmission panel for Bluetooth and Dante. It connects to mobile phones, iPad, and other devices through Bluetooth interface, and converts the received audio signal into digital signal transmission through Dante network. Power, control, and audio data are transmitted by only one network cable, and there is no need to worry about ground loops or other audio issues.
The Bluetooth Audio to Dante Interface is designed to be compatible with standard single gang US wallboxes with Decora faceplates.
